Android P 系统文档:深入了解 Android 9.040


Android P,也被称为 Android 9.0,是谷歌开发的移动操作系统 Android 的第 16 个主要版本。它于 2018 年 8 月发布,为 Android 设备引入了许多新功能和改进。本文档将深入探讨 Android P 系统架构、新特性、性能优化和安全性增强等方面。

系统架构

Android P 延续了 Android 操作系统的模块化结构。它由以下主要组件组成:
Linux 内核:管理设备的硬件和资源。
HAL(硬件抽象层):为不同硬件设备提供统一的接口。
系统服务器:处理核心系统服务,例如活动和服务管理。
Android 运行时 (ART):Java 虚拟机,用于运行 Android 应用程序。
应用程序框架:提供针对应用程序开发者的 API 和服务。

新特性

Android P 引入了许多新特性,包括:
凹槽显示支持:对具有凹槽或切口的显示器的支持。
手势导航:新的导航系统,使用基于手势的交互而不是导航栏。
数字健康:一组工具,用于帮助用户管理其设备使用情况和数字健康。
自适应电池:优化电池使用,根据使用模式调整应用程序的资源分配。
自适应亮度:根据周围环境自动调整屏幕亮度。

性能优化

Android P 针对性能进行了多项优化,包括:
后台限制:限制后台应用程序的活动,以提高电池续航能力和减少内存使用。
JIT 编译:将应用程序代码在运行时编译为机器码,提高性能。
GPU 加速:将更多系统操作卸载到 GPU,从而提高图形性能。

安全性增强

安全是 Android P 的主要重点,它包括以下增强功能:
Android Biometric API:一种统一的 API,用于访问设备的生物识别功能,例如指纹扫描仪和面部识别。
TLS 1.3 支持:提高网络通信的安全性。
更严格的权限控制:限制应用程序访问敏感设备数据的权限。


Android P 是一次重要的 Android 操作系统更新,引入了许多新功能、性能优化和安全性增强。它为用户提供了更加现代且直观的用户界面、更长的电池续航时间以及增强的数据保护。随着时间的推移,Android P 将继续发展并改进,并为 Android 设备带来新的创新。

2024-11-26


上一篇:Linux 操作系统:深入指南

下一篇:Linux 安装系统 U 盘启动盘制作工具大全